Grasping the Jobs of a User Experience Designer and Product Designer

As the tech world continues to evolve, so do the roles of a UX professional. Cooperating with Design experts, these experts are central in forming the UX of services and products.

A User Experience Designer is responsible for improving user happiness by improving the usability and engagement between the consumer and the service. Sometimes mistaken for the Product Designer role, the two share common ground but are not the same.

Looked at predominantly in digital products, a Design expert's duty includes ideas from UX/UI Design, graphic design, and user interaction to make a efficient and visually pleasing design.

A UX Designer focuses their efforts on the customer— understanding their desires, likes, and habits through diverse research techniques. This click here strategy, referred to as User-Centered Design, makes sure the creation is developed with the consumer's requirements and experience in consideration.

The creation of a design guide— a exhaustive series of components, principles, and design standards— is another task of UX Designers. This collection aids in keeping consistency across multiple products and enhances efficiency.

Prototipagem and user testing are key steps in the creation process. A model is a early model of the product that helps spot potential problems and areas for enhancement. User testing are then conducted to assess the creation's ease of use and effectiveness.

The arrangement and comprehension of data— known as data design— helps upgrade the product's intuitiveness and end-user experience.

Finally, feedback from real users— obtained through user research— provides priceless insights that aid in improvements and future design evolution.

Tools such as Figma, a cloud-based prototyping and design tool—are valuable assets for User Experience Designers, aiding in collaborative work and sharing designs with ease.

In essence, the duties of a UX Designer and Product Designer offer an essential contribution to the improvement, creation, and evolution of designs. Through a all-encompassing approach, involving research, design, and testing, they ensure products are user-friendly, efficient, and meet user needs.
